Oliseh Confirms Madrid Interest in Osimhen

Super Eagles legend Sunday Oliseh has confirmed that Real Madrid are genuinely interested in signing Victor Osimhen, though he refused to divulge the source of his information.

Osimhen has been one of the most sought-after strikers in the world since helping Napoli win the Italian Serie A title in the 2022/23 season. After a complicated transfer saga, he eventually joined Galatasaray permanently in the summer of 2025 following a season-long loan.

During his loan at the Turkish club last season, he led the team to Turkish Super Lig and domestic cup titles while also finishing as the league’s top scorer.

His stock has risen in Turkey as he continues to score goals at an elite level. According to Transfermarkt, his performance in the UEFA Champions League this season, where he has scored six goals in three matches, has further alerted European clubs.

Spanish giants Real Madrid have reportedly listed the Nigerian forward as a priority target to give their explosive attack a focal point.

Speaking on the Global Football Insight Podcast, Oliseh said, “Real Madrid have the luxury now that they can say to Vinicius, go, because if you go, Mbappe can now go back to his natural position. So, it is not as if we lose you and we lose something.

“And there’s a lot of talk under the ground about the possibility of Osimhen being a candidate. I am not going to tell you how I got this information, but there’s a lot of talk. Let’s see how this plays out. But when I heard it from a top personality, I was happy for the young man.”

If the move materialises, it will allow Kylian Mbappe to move back to his preferred left wing role, while Osimhen will occupy the number nine position.

However, the deal will not come cheaply as Galatasaray are expected to demand at least €100m to sell the Nigerian forward, who will cost Madrid more than €20 million per year in wages.
